For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 94 students in Skyline Schools. This district's average high test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public high schools in Kansas.
Public High School in Skyline School have an average math proficiency score of 35% (versus the Kansas public high school average of 22%), and reading proficiency score of 30% (versus the 26% statewide average).
Public High School in Skyline School have a Graduation Rate of 80%, which is less than the Kansas average of 87%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Skyline High School, with ≥80%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Kansas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 10%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Kansas public high school average of 37%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$17,287 is higher than the state median of $16,284. The school district revenue/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$15,809 is less than the state median of $17,200. The school district spending/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
